Google measures user experience with three metrics: Largest Contentful Paint (LCP), Cumulative Layout Shift (CLS), and Interaction to Next Paint (INP) [1]. The Custom and Headless Advantage
Headless architecture decouples your website's front-end from its back-end management. This setup lets developers serve ultra-fast, static HTML directly through global CDNs. Without database queries or heavy plugins slowing down user actions, your site loads instantly, offering a massive SEO advantage.

1. Implement Clean, Custom-Engineered Code
- Drop page builders: Rebuild slow landing pages with streamlined custom code.
- Optimize LCP: Preload hero images, inline critical CSS, and remove render-blocking scripts to hit the 2.0-second limit [1].
- Fix layout shifts: Set exact width and height dimensions for every image and media asset.
2. Move Beyond Vanity Metrics to Continuous Monitoring
Occasional lab tests (like a single Lighthouse run) are highly unreliable. Google ranks your site using real-world field data collected from actual Chrome users over a rolling 28-day window. If a script slows down your checkout page during busy hours, a manual lab test won't catch it—but Google's crawlers will.
